Title TF ChIP-seq from whole organism (ENCSR686FKU)
Project modENCODE
Organism Caenorhabditis elegans
Experiment type Genome binding/occupancy profiling by high throughput sequencing
Summary ChIP-seq of transgenic worms expressing ZIP-5-eGFP fusion proteins. The IP was performed using an anti-GFP antibody.
